TWS F9 Earbud One Side Not Charging or Showing Battery Percentage – Fault Analysis & Fix

User question

One side is not working, example when put into the case, the sid that isnt working doesnt show the battery percentage

Artificial Intelligence Response

Direct answer to the question

  • The earbud that doesn’t show a battery percentage in the case is almost certainly not making proper electrical contact with the case, is deeply discharged, or is desynchronized from the other earbud. Start with cleaning and seating checks, then perform the model‑specific reset (triple‑tap both touchpads while they’re in the case), and finally try a prolonged charge. If the problem follows the earbud (not the case slot) after cross‑testing, the earbud’s battery or charging circuit is likely faulty.

Detailed problem analysis

  • Why the percentage doesn’t appear

    • The F9 case only shows per‑earbud percentage when it senses charging/communication through the two gold contacts. Any contamination, misalignment, stuck pogo pin, or a battery that is below its protection threshold will look like “no earbud present,” so no percentage is shown.
  • Mechanical/contact causes (most common) 1) Dirty or oxidized contacts:

    • Clean both gold pads on the earbud and the two spring‑loaded pins in the case with 90%+ isopropyl alcohol using a cotton swab; let dry 1 minute. 2) Earbud not seating fully:
    • Remove the silicone eartip on the problem side and insert the bare earbud; ensure magnets pull it down firmly and the lid closes without resistance.
    • Press‑and‑wiggle test: with the earbud in, gently press it down and wiggle. If the display/LED flickers or the percentage momentarily appears, you have a seating/contact issue (try smaller eartips or clean again). 3) Stuck/broken pogo pin in the case:
    • Lightly press each gold pin with a wooden toothpick; both must spring back equally. If one is stuck low, the case slot is faulty.
  • Electrical causes 1) Deeply discharged earbud cell:

    • With the case connected to wall power, leave the problem earbud in the case for 2–4 hours even if no percentage appears initially. Many cells need a pre‑charge before LEDs/percentages wake up.
    • “Wake” method: remove/reinsert the earbud several times over 1–2 minutes; this can help the charger IC re‑negotiate pre‑charge. 2) Low case battery:
    • Charge the case to ≥50% before testing; many cases limit earbud charge current when they are low. 3) Case slot vs earbud isolation:
    • Cross‑test: put the working earbud in the “bad” slot and the bad earbud in the “good” slot.
      • If the slot never shows percentage with either earbud → case slot problem.
      • If the problem follows the earbud regardless of slot → earbud battery/charging PCB fault.
  • Firmware/pairing causes

    • Desynchronization between L/R can make one side appear offline even if it has charge. Do a full reset:
    • On most F9 variants: place both earbuds in the case, keep the lid open, then triple‑tap both touchpads at the same time. You should see both earbuds flash twice; close the lid for ~10 seconds.
    • “Forget” the earbuds on the phone’s Bluetooth list, then open the lid, remove both earbuds together, let them pair to each other (one will become “master”), and reconnect to the phone.
    • Alternative reset (for buttoned variants): with earbuds out and powered off, press‑and‑hold both buttons 15–20 seconds until the LEDs cycle, then return them to the case for 10 seconds and re‑pair.
  • Less common hardware faults

    • Earbud Li‑Po cell aged or open‑circuit lead: earbud may play briefly but never shows charge/percentage. Replacement requires micro‑soldering a 3.7 V, ~30–50 mAh cell—often not economical versus replacement.
    • Case charging rail or sense line failure on one slot: multimeter across the two pogo pins (carefully, lid open) should show a few volts when the slot is “active.” No voltage on one slot with a known‑good earbud inserted indicates a case fault.

Supporting explanations and details

  • How the case “knows” to show a percentage:
    • The case MCU looks for a load and/or a sense pin state when an earbud makes contact; only then does it attempt to read/report charge state or at least display that the earbud is charging. No contact → no display.
  • Why deep discharge hides the indicator:
    • The earbud’s battery protection IC opens when cell voltage falls too low. The charger inside the earbud enters a pre‑charge regime at a very low current; indicators often remain off until the cell reaches a safe threshold.

Practical guidelines

  • Quick checklist to run now (5–10 minutes): 1) Clean pads/pins with IPA; remove the eartip and re‑seat the earbud; press‑and‑wiggle test. 2) Fully charge the case; then insert only the bad earbud and close the lid for 30 minutes. 3) Do the F9 reset (triple‑tap both touchpads while in the case), then forget and re‑pair on the phone. 4) Cross‑test earbud vs slot to localize the fault.
  • If localized to the earbud:
    • Try a 2–4 hour deep charge with the case plugged in.
    • If still no detection or percentage, the earbud battery/charging board is likely defective → replace the earbud or the set.
  • If localized to the case slot:
    • Inspect/unstick pogo pin; if mechanically damaged, replace the case or the entire set.
